BBC’s Global Impact hyuniiiv, 2025년 03월 02일 BBC’s Global Impact Imagine waking up to the sound of news from around the world, delivered in a way that feels both familiar and trustworthy. For many of us, that source is the BBC, a global leader in news and media. But what makes the BBC so important, and how does it impact our daily lives? Let’s dive into the world of the BBC and explore its significance, its strengths, and its challenges. The BBC is renowned for its impartial and comprehensive coverage of global events. Whether it’s breaking news, in-depth analysis, or documentaries, the BBC offers a wide range of content that caters to diverse interests and needs. Its global reach is unparalleled, with services like BBC News, BBC World Service, and BBC iPlayer providing access to news, entertainment, and educational programs in multiple languages. This accessibility makes the BBC a go-to source for people seeking reliable information about current events. One of the key strengths of the BBC is its commitment to public service broadcasting. Unlike many commercial networks, the BBC is funded by a license fee paid by households in the UK, which allows it to maintain a level of independence and objectivity in its reporting. This model supports the creation of high-quality content that is not driven by advertising revenue, ensuring that the focus remains on informing and educating the public rather than solely on generating profits. However, the BBC also faces challenges in the modern media landscape. With the rise of digital platforms and social media, traditional broadcasting models are under pressure. The BBC must adapt to these changes by innovating its content delivery and engaging with audiences in new ways. For instance, the BBC has expanded its online presence through services like BBC Sounds and BBC iPlayer, offering on-demand access to a vast library of programs. In addition to its news and entertainment offerings, the BBC plays a significant role in promoting British culture and values globally. Its educational programs, such as those offered by BBC Learning, help children and adults alike develop new skills and gain knowledge. The BBC also supports emerging talent through initiatives like the BBC Writersroom, which provides opportunities for new writers to develop their work. Despite these strengths, the BBC is not immune to criticism. Some argue that its funding model is outdated and that it should be more accountable to the public. Others point to instances where the BBC’s impartiality has been questioned, highlighting the need for continuous improvement in maintaining its journalistic standards. In conclusion, the BBC remains a vital part of the global media landscape, offering a unique blend of news, entertainment, and education that resonates with audiences worldwide. Its commitment to public service broadcasting and its ability to adapt to changing times are key factors in its enduring success. As we navigate the complexities of the digital age, the BBC serves as a beacon of reliable information and cultural exchange. English Aston Villa vs Chelsea: A Clash of Ambitions and Styles 2025년 02월 23일 Aston Villa vs Chelsea is a highly anticipated fixture in the Premier League, showcasing the talents of two historic clubs and often impacting league standings. The rivalry has produced memorable moments, with Aston Villa showing significant improvement in recent seasons. They are now a formidable opponent for top teams, including Chelsea, thanks to their energetic play and passionate home crowd. Recent encounters highlight the competitive nature of this match-up, where Chelsea aims to dominate mid-table teams while Aston Villa seeks to disrupt those plans. The tactical aspects of the clashes are intriguing, as Chelsea typically plays a possession-based game, while Aston Villa often exploits flanks to outmaneuver their opponents. As both teams strive for better positions in the league, the stakes are ever higher, with intense passion from fans and players.
